put in the support for 'router twins'

basically, a twin is a router which is different except it shares
the same keypair. so in cases where we want to find a "next router"
and all we really care is that it can decrypt the next onion layer,
then a twin is just as good.

we still need to decide how to mark twins in the routerinfo_t and in
the routers config file.
